Well, there's a trade off in that the lower the poly count, the easier it is to get a water-tight model as it is derived from a primitive. The low-poly look is also deliberate (I've been working on some scenes using this style), so I would want to retain it - the biggest difficulty is that some 3D printing - certainly SLS in plastics - has difficulty producing sharp edges so the low-poly effect could be spoiled.
